Abstract A high statistics data sample of the decays of $$K^+$$ K+ mesons to three charged particles was accumulated by the OKA experiment in 2012 and 2013. This allowed to select a clean sample of ...about 450 events with $$K^{+}\rightarrow \pi ^{+}\pi ^{-}\pi ^{+}\gamma $$ K+→π+π-π+γ decays with the energy of the photon in the kaon rest frame greater than 30 MeV. The measured branching fraction of the $$K^{+}\rightarrow \pi ^{+}\pi ^{-}\pi ^{+}\gamma $$ K+→π+π-π+γ , with $$E_{\gamma }^{*} > 30\ \hbox {MeV}$$ Eγ∗>30MeV is equal to $$(0.71 \pm 0.05) \times 10^{-5}$$ (0.71±0.05)×10-5 . The measured differential branching fraction over photon energy is compared with the prediction of the chiral perturbation theory to $${\mathcal {O}}(p^{4})$$ O(p4) . A search for an up-down asymmetry of the photon with respect to the hadronic system decay plane is also performed.

Abstract A high statistics data sample of the $$K^{+}\rightarrow \mu ^{+}\nu _{\mu }$$ K+→μ+νμ decay was accumulated by the OKA experiment in 2012. The missing mass analysis was performed to search ...for the decay channel $$K^{+}\rightarrow \mu ^{+}\nu _{H}$$ K+→μ+νH with a hypothetic stable heavy neutrino in the final state. The obtained missing mass spectrum does not show peaks that could be attributed to existence of stable heavy neutrinos in the mass range $$(270< m_{\nu _{H}} < 375)$$ (270<mνH<375) MeV$$/c^{2}$$ /c2 . As a result, upper limits on the branching ratio and on the value of the mixing element $$|U_{\mu H}|^{2}$$ |UμH|2 are obtained.

In the process of optimization of heterologous expression of thermostable chemotaxis proteins CheW and CheY as industrially useful polypeptides, their direct influence on the cell growth kinetics and ...morphology of
Escherichia coli
was observed. CheW and CheY of bacteria of the genus
Thermotoga
, being expressed in recombinant form in
E. coli
cells, are involved in the corresponding signal pathways of the mesophilic microorganisms. The effects of such involvement in the metabolism of “host” cells are extremely diverse: from rapid aging of the culture to elongation of the stationary growth phase. We also discuss the mechanisms of the influence of the heterologous chemotaxis proteins on cells, their positive and negative effects, as well as potential applications in industry and biomedicine.
The article discusses the applicability of the theory of disasters and nonlinear dynamics in predicting the systemic risks of managing the digital economy and Internet of things systems. One of the ...approaches may be modeling of nonlinear processes based on the use of the concepts of catastrophe theory. Studies have shown a key indicator of such modeling is to determine the essential features of the disaster. The study showed that the widely used models of the economic processes of the digital economy, as well as the software and technical components of the internet of things, can be transformed into the canonical equation of «assembly», which subsequently leads to the emergence of such an area in the space of phase development variables in which jumps can occur or for the better, or vice versa, such as a collapse. Currently, in the digital economy, the study of such phenomena seems to be very relevant, since an uncontrolled «spasmodic» change in the functioning parameters of such systems can lead to disastrous consequences for the functioning of all interconnected subsystems. The collapse or unstable behavior of one of the components of such systems can lead to the collapse of the entire system. Such phenomena are not allowed in the digital economy and can trigger not only economic consequences, but also social ones.
The work is devoted to one of the aspects related to the resolution of disputes over the boundaries of land plots. Recently, the number of these disputes has been steadily growing, which confirms the ...relevance of the chosen topic. Border disputes are currently resolved only through the courts, almost always with a forensic land surveying. The aspect considered in the article concerns the accuracy of constructing models of the objects of surveying, since software products used do not have documentary evidence of the accuracy of the created models. Therefore, experts need to independently test the models for accuracy. Moreover, such tests make it possible to reveal expert errors at the modeling stage. The paper proposes the authors’ method of testing for the accuracy of a computer-graphic model of objects, studied by a forensic land surveying.
